GA Veterans Day 2017: Parades, Ceremonies, Free Meals And More
Georgia's military veterans will be honored at parades, wreath-laying ceremonies, even with free meals. See list of events and perks below.

ATLANTA, GA — Georgia's military veterans will be saluted at events across the state this weekend, from wreath-laying ceremonies at memorials and cemeteries in the Atlanta region to parades, free admission at the Georgia Aquarium, free community breakfasts and free meals at many restaurants.
Some events are on Friday, while others are on Veterans Day observed this Saturday, Nov. 11.
